Explorar el Código

Functions - new public header structure (#6193)

Paul Beusterien hace 5 años
padre
commit
67c333e4cc

+ 1 - 1
FirebaseFunctions.podspec

@@ -28,7 +28,7 @@ Cloud Functions for Firebase.
     'Interop/Auth/Public/*.h',
     'FirebaseCore/Sources/Private/*.h',
   ]
-  s.public_header_files = 'Functions/FirebaseFunctions/Public/*.h'
+  s.public_header_files = 'Functions/FirebaseFunctions/Public/FirebaseFunctions/*.h'
 
   s.dependency 'FirebaseCore', '~> 6.8'
   s.dependency 'GTMSessionFetcher/Core', '~> 1.1'

+ 3 - 3
Functions/Example/IntegrationTests/FIRIntegrationTests.m

@@ -19,9 +19,9 @@
 #import "FIRAuthInteropFake.h"
 #import "Functions/Example/TestUtils/FUNFakeInstanceID.h"
 #import "Functions/FirebaseFunctions/FIRFunctions+Internal.h"
-#import "Functions/FirebaseFunctions/Public/FIRError.h"
-#import "Functions/FirebaseFunctions/Public/FIRFunctions.h"
-#import "Functions/FirebaseFunctions/Public/FIRHTTPSCallable.h"
+#import "Functions/FirebaseFunctions/Public/FirebaseFunctions/FIRError.h"
+#import "Functions/FirebaseFunctions/Public/FirebaseFunctions/FIRFunctions.h"
+#import "Functions/FirebaseFunctions/Public/FirebaseFunctions/FIRHTTPSCallable.h"
 
 // Project ID used by these tests.
 static NSString *const kDefaultProjectID = @"functions-integration-test";

+ 1 - 1
Functions/Example/Tests/FIRFunctionsTests.m

@@ -15,7 +15,7 @@
 #import <XCTest/XCTest.h>
 
 #import "Functions/FirebaseFunctions/FIRFunctions+Internal.h"
-#import "Functions/FirebaseFunctions/Public/FIRFunctions.h"
+#import "Functions/FirebaseFunctions/Public/FirebaseFunctions/FIRFunctions.h"
 
 @interface FIRFunctionsTests : XCTestCase
 @end

+ 1 - 1
Functions/Example/Tests/FUNSerializerTests.m

@@ -15,7 +15,7 @@
 #import <XCTest/XCTest.h>
 
 #import "Functions/FirebaseFunctions/FUNSerializer.h"
-#import "Functions/FirebaseFunctions/Public/FIRError.h"
+#import "Functions/FirebaseFunctions/Public/FirebaseFunctions/FIRError.h"
 
 @interface FUNSerializerTests : XCTestCase
 @end

+ 1 - 1
Functions/FirebaseFunctions/FIRFunctions+Internal.h

@@ -14,7 +14,7 @@
 
 #import <Foundation/Foundation.h>
 
-#import "Functions/FirebaseFunctions/Public/FIRFunctions.h"
+#import "Functions/FirebaseFunctions/Public/FirebaseFunctions/FIRFunctions.h"
 
 @protocol FIRAuthInterop;
 @class FIRHTTPSCallableResult;

+ 3 - 3
Functions/FirebaseFunctions/FIRFunctions.m

@@ -12,7 +12,7 @@
 // See the License for the specific language governing permissions and
 // limitations under the License.
 
-#import "Functions/FirebaseFunctions/Public/FIRFunctions.h"
+#import "Functions/FirebaseFunctions/Public/FirebaseFunctions/FIRFunctions.h"
 #import "Functions/FirebaseFunctions/FIRFunctions+Internal.h"
 
 #import "FirebaseCore/Sources/Private/FirebaseCoreInternal.h"
@@ -23,8 +23,8 @@
 #import "Functions/FirebaseFunctions/FUNError.h"
 #import "Functions/FirebaseFunctions/FUNSerializer.h"
 #import "Functions/FirebaseFunctions/FUNUsageValidation.h"
-#import "Functions/FirebaseFunctions/Public/FIRError.h"
-#import "Functions/FirebaseFunctions/Public/FIRHTTPSCallable.h"
+#import "Functions/FirebaseFunctions/Public/FirebaseFunctions/FIRError.h"
+#import "Functions/FirebaseFunctions/Public/FirebaseFunctions/FIRHTTPSCallable.h"
 
 #if SWIFT_PACKAGE
 @import GTMSessionFetcherCore;

+ 1 - 1
Functions/FirebaseFunctions/FIRHTTPSCallable+Internal.h

@@ -14,7 +14,7 @@
 
 #import <Foundation/Foundation.h>
 
-#import "Functions/FirebaseFunctions/Public/FIRHTTPSCallable.h"
+#import "Functions/FirebaseFunctions/Public/FirebaseFunctions/FIRHTTPSCallable.h"
 
 @class FIRFunctions;
 

+ 1 - 1
Functions/FirebaseFunctions/FIRHTTPSCallable.m

@@ -12,7 +12,7 @@
 // See the License for the specific language governing permissions and
 // limitations under the License.
 
-#import "Functions/FirebaseFunctions/Public/FIRHTTPSCallable.h"
+#import "Functions/FirebaseFunctions/Public/FirebaseFunctions/FIRHTTPSCallable.h"
 #import "Functions/FirebaseFunctions/FIRHTTPSCallable+Internal.h"
 
 #import "Functions/FirebaseFunctions/FIRFunctions+Internal.h"

+ 1 - 1
Functions/FirebaseFunctions/FUNError.h

@@ -14,7 +14,7 @@
 // limitations under the License.
 
 #import <Foundation/Foundation.h>
-#import "Functions/FirebaseFunctions/Public/FIRError.h"
+#import "Functions/FirebaseFunctions/Public/FirebaseFunctions/FIRError.h"
 
 @class FUNSerializer;
 

+ 1 - 1
Functions/FirebaseFunctions/FUNSerializer.m

@@ -15,7 +15,7 @@
 #import "Functions/FirebaseFunctions/FUNSerializer.h"
 
 #import "Functions/FirebaseFunctions/FUNUsageValidation.h"
-#import "Functions/FirebaseFunctions/Public/FIRError.h"
+#import "Functions/FirebaseFunctions/Public/FirebaseFunctions/FIRError.h"
 
 NS_ASSUME_NONNULL_BEGIN
 

+ 0 - 0
Functions/FirebaseFunctions/Public/FIRError.h → Functions/FirebaseFunctions/Public/FirebaseFunctions/FIRError.h


+ 0 - 0
Functions/FirebaseFunctions/Public/FIRFunctions.h → Functions/FirebaseFunctions/Public/FirebaseFunctions/FIRFunctions.h


+ 0 - 0
Functions/FirebaseFunctions/Public/FIRHTTPSCallable.h → Functions/FirebaseFunctions/Public/FirebaseFunctions/FIRHTTPSCallable.h


+ 0 - 0
Functions/FirebaseFunctions/Public/FirebaseFunctions.h → Functions/FirebaseFunctions/Public/FirebaseFunctions/FirebaseFunctions.h


+ 4 - 4
SwiftPMTests/objc-import-test/objc-header.m

@@ -12,25 +12,25 @@
 // See the License for the specific language governing permissions and
 // limitations under the License.
 
+#import "Firebase.h"
 #import "FirebaseABTesting/FirebaseABTesting.h"
 #import "FirebaseAuth/FirebaseAuth.h"
-//#import "FirebaseFunctions/FirebaseFunctions.h"
-#import "Firebase.h"
 #import "FirebaseCore/FirebaseCore.h"
 #import "FirebaseCrashlytics/FirebaseCrashlytics.h"
 #import "FirebaseDatabase/FirebaseDatabase.h"
+#import "FirebaseFunctions/FirebaseFunctions.h"
 //#import "FirebaseFirestore/FirebaseFirestore."
 #import "FirebaseInstallations/FirebaseInstallations.h"
 #import "FirebaseRemoteConfig/FirebaseRemoteConfig.h"
 #import "FirebaseStorage/FirebaseStorage.h"
 
+#import <Firebase.h>
 #import <FirebaseABTesting/FirebaseABTesting.h>
 #import <FirebaseAuth/FirebaseAuth.h>
-//#import <FirebaseFunctions/FirebaseFunctions.h>
-#import <Firebase.h>
 #import <FirebaseCore/FirebaseCore.h>
 #import <FirebaseCrashlytics/FirebaseCrashlytics.h>
 #import <FirebaseDatabase/FirebaseDatabase.h>
+#import <FirebaseFunctions/FirebaseFunctions.h>
 //#import <FirebaseFirestore/FirebaseFirestore.>
 #import <FirebaseInstallations/FirebaseInstallations.h>
 #import <FirebaseRemoteConfig/FirebaseRemoteConfig.h>